WebNov 24, 2015 · Clicker training is a popular technique used in companion animal training. It employs a handheld sig-nalling device called a clicker, which emits an audible “click” noise when pressed. Trainers press the clicker when an animal performs a desired behaviour, usually following the click with presentation of a food reward. WebClicker vs Verbal Praise. A clicker provides a more consistent way to highlight and reward behaviors compared to other approaches such as verbal praise. The click of a clicker always sounds exactly the same. … WebClicker training began to grow in popularity among dog trainers following the publication of Karen Pryor's book Don't Shoot the Dog in 1984.
